Transaction d1bd86dc13a94a1a316e5791e64895e17aa2f21b9e9506a7762b2680661253e2
1 Input
1 Output
-
d1bd86dc13a94a1a316e5791e64895e17aa2f21b9e9506a7762b2680661253e2:0
- value
- 75430369
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7c6b242163a0db590e8739be754e288c4bf4c77 OP_EQUAL
- address
- 3QH8rb5CsFr3SNznZXndL3MBkggLqBAbBc